Meningococcal disease is on the rise; nearly half of cases occur in children under 15 years of age – Parents should take proactive measures for effective prevention
123 14/04/2026According to statistics from the Ministry of Health, from epidemiological week 1 to week 14 of 2026, Viet Nam recorded 24 cases of meningococcal disease, including 4 deaths. Cases were concentrated primarily in children under 15 years of age, accounting for up... Read more
